How do you grow a Red Baron peach tree?

Growing Red Baron Peaches

The site should be full sun and out of strong wind. Avoid planting in frost pockets. Soak bare root trees for several hours prior to planting. Build a little pyramid of soil at the bottom of a hole that is twice as wide and deep as the roots.

Where are red haven peaches grown?

Red Havenpeaches grow in U.S. Department of Agriculture plant hardiness zones 5 through 9 and should be planted in full sun and well-drained soil, spaced 18 to 20 feet apart. “Red Haven” produces large, yellow freestone peaches that are ready for harvest midseason.
